The Honda CR-V is now in its fourth generation, with a story that began in 1995 and with increasing success, as well as that of the SUV segment. The new version is small, given the general trend of downsizing, but this did not alter the interior of the car, where they can always safely be seated five people. In addition it has been increased by 147 liters space for the load.

At the aesthetic level, the CR-V offers a more aggressive and square look, giving more attention to European customers, with the introduction of LED lights. A particular attention is given to the interior with ergonomic seats, spaciousness and better soundproofing, set up with a sound isolating material, placed in the floor under the passenger compartment and it comes double-sealed doors. Two engines are available for this model: the 2.0-liter petrol i-VTEC 155 hp 2WD or 4WD and 4WD 2.2 i-DTEC diesel with 150 hp. The the evolution of the previous generation engines comes with more attention to fuel consumption and emissions. On the petrol version now it is present the ‘Econ’, function for a more regular increase of the torque and therefore and it also has a greater efficiency of the fuel.

One of the major strengths of the CR-V is given by the technology, in particular for the driver assistance systems. Among the most interesting are the Adaptive Cruise Control and Lane Keeping Assist System. The first maintains constant speed and automatically brakes if the distance to the car ahead of us over the edge is reduced, while the other is detected if you are going to leave the lane and automatically applies at a corrective steering.
